"THAT NIGHT "BUTCHER" PETE GOT KNOCKED OUT BY JESSIE "THE CANNON" TESORI" by Jonathan Cook

THAT NIGHT "BUTCHER" PETE GOT KNOCKED OUT BY JESSIE "THE CANNON" TESORI: World class heavyweight champion fighter, “Butcher” Pete Wilcox, is at the peak of his career – a living legend with a winning streak to brag about. He never expected, however, that his undefeated record would end in an exhibition match with Jessie “The Cannon” Tesori – a lightweight contender from the women’s fighting division.

Written and directed by Jonathan Cook

Performed by Ian Russell as "Butcher Pete", Bonnie Marie Williams as "Jessie 'The Cannon' Tesori", Robb Smith as "Mikey B.", & Valentin Angel Fernandez and Jonathan Cook as the Ring Annoucers.

About the writer: Jonathan Cook is heavily involved in the fine arts as an actor, writer, and filmmaker based in South Carolina. Many of his short plays have been produced in theatres around the World and and his full length play INSURGENTES was a semi-finalist in the 2020 Screencraft Stage Play Contest and the SE Texas Festival of New Plays. He is a five-time recipient of the Porter Fleming Literary Award in the playwriting category and some of his works have been published in anthologies by Smith & Kraus, Black Bed Sheet Books, Ghost Light Publications, and Ardneh. Aside from playwriting, he has also written and directed several short films that have been presented in regional film festivals as well as distributed internationally on ShortsTV. He is also the host and producer of the radio theater podcast GATHER BY THE GHOST LIGHT. Launched in 2020, GATHER BY THE GHOST LIGHT is a collection of stage plays adapted to an audio only format performed by voice actors and edited with appropriate sound effects and music.

I was born and raised in Augusta, GA. I started in radio by interning at a local rock station, WRXR, while I was still in high school. My first paying radio gig out of school was in Greenville, SC doing Saturday mornings. I barely made enough money to pay for the gas to get me back and forth on the 5 hour round trip to do my show but I had been bitten by not only the radio bug but the entertainment bug! I loved entertaining and getting to know people. I bounced around from station to station, as you do, for years. Picking up stories and perspectives along the way. I probably learned the most about how to treat people who are your listeners from the time I spent in Birmingham, AL producing the Patti & Dollar Bill morning show on WDXB. They were true radio legends and it was a privilege to learn from them and an honor to call them friends. From there I moved back to Augusta to be closer to family. You can often find me on stage with one of the great theatre groups here in town. I can also be seen and heard in several television commercials nationally and you might even catch a glimpse of me in some movies too. I love photography, cooking, and my pup, Magnolia the Malshi.

From Los Angeles to the East Coast and back again, Bonnie Marie Williams has been acting for over 25 years on the stage, and in television and film; as a voice actor for clients including Marvel's Avengers STATION, Pokemon, Nintendo Switch, and Spotify, and producing feature films and podcasts. She loves all things Halloween and Batman, and has seen Buffy the Vampire Slayer more times than she can count. When she's not recording in the studio, she's drinking too much coffee, casting and directing voiceover projects, teaching classes to kids and grown-ups, trying out a new recipe or two, talking to ghosts, and watching Star Wars.
